CVE-2026-31754

The CVE-2026-31754 issue affects the Linux kernel’s USB DRD/CDNS3 gadget path. When cdns3_gadget_start() fails, the DRD hardware remains in gadget mode while software state is INACTIVE, causing hardware/software state inconsistency.
